Pursuant to the Freedom of Information Act, I hereby request the following records:
In the United States, the Federal Bureau of Investigation defines “eco-terrorism” as “the use or threatened use of violence of a criminal nature against innocent victims or property by an environmentally-oriented, subnational group for environmental-political reasons, or aimed at an audience beyond the target, often of a symbolic nature.” (https://archives.fbi.gov/archives/news/testimony/the-threat-of-eco-terrorism)
In this vein, I request records relating to the following US organizations that have been accused of eco-terrorist activity: Animal Liberation Front (ALF), the Earth Liberation Front (ELF), Greenpeace, the Sea Shepherd Conservation Society, People for the Ethical Treatment of Animals (PETA), Earth First!, The Coalition to Save the Preserves, and the Hardesty Avengers.
Please conduct a search of the Central Records System, including but not limited to the Electronic Surveillance (ELSUR) Indices, the Microphone Surveillance (MISUR) Indices, the Physical Surveillance (FISUR) Indices, and the Technical Surveillance (TESUR) Indices, for both main-file records and cross-reference records that mention the above organizations.
Please include documents that could include but are not limited to: criminal profiles, reports, investigations, and relevant internal communications to the aforementioned groups both paper and digital (such as emails, text messages, PDF documents, word processing or slide documents, and spreadsheets).
